Priest assaulted and robbed at Holy Family Church Kirkholt
Date published: 12/12/2005
Police were called to the Holy Family Church on Mornington Road at 3.35pm on Saturday 10 December 2005, following reports that a priest had been assaulted and robbed.
Between 3.05pm and 3.35pm the priest answered the door to three men who told him they were homeless and asked for money and food.
He provided them with refreshments and cash but they then attacked the man and forced him to hand over more cash. They then tied the priest up and left the scene in his car, a light blue Renault Laguna.
The car was later found abandoned on Channing Street in Newbold.
The first man is described as a white man aged in his early 20s. He was 5'8'' tall, of medium build with short dark hair.
The second man was described as a dark skinned man, possibly Asian, aged in his late 20s - early 30s. He was 6'2'' tall, of large build and had a deep voice and stubble. He was wearing a dark coloured woolen hat and a dark colored bomber style jacket
The third man was described as white.
The men were all heard to speak with Irish accents and one of them was referred to as either Jum Jum or Jon Jon.
Detective Sergeant Jared Sudworth from Rochdale CID said: "These offenders took advantage of this man's generosity and stole money from him. He showed them nothing but kindness and it is reprehensible that they could treat anybody - let alone someone who has shown compassion - like this.
"I hope the actions of these individuals do not make people think twice about helping those who need it, especially at this time of year. The public can help repay some faith by coming forward if they have any information.
